The Issue: Traffic that Doesn't Convert
When we first started to run TikTok campaigns in-house, the hype was real:
- Our videos receive thousands of hits in hours
- CTRs were higher than Facebook or Instagram
- We saw an increase in website traffic
But here is the truth: our ROI was not good enough. We were spending money on ads, but sales were not occurring. Why?
What Went Wrong
- Generic creatives: Advertisements looked like generic social clips, not created natively on TikTok.
- No product labeling: Users had to click off of TikTok to buy, and there was friction.
- No retargeting plan: We lost conversions from customers who did not convert on first visit.
- Limited trend adoption: We didn't have the cultural signals that TikTok feeds on.
The outcome? Low conversions, high CPC, and an ROAS that struggled to break even.

What the Agency Did Differently
This is how the agency transformed our campaigns:1. Repurposed Ad Creatives for TikTok Native Format
The first change? Authenticity over perfection.TikTok is not Instagram. It prefers real content, something that is relatable, and community-driven. The agency abandoned our glossy product videos and introduced:
- Hook-first narration: Engaging the audience at the very first 2 seconds.
- UGC-style content: Video that mimics organic creator posts.
- Trend-leveraged editing: Leverage trending sounds, captions, and challenges.
Example:
Instead of a static product display, they designed:
"POV: You finally discovered the only skincare that actually works"—with an actual person walking you through it.
2. Product Tagging Using TikTok Shop
Friction kills conversions. Before, the users would click our ad → visit a website → fill the cart → maybe buy.The agency responded to this by:
- Facilitating TikTok Shop integration
- Product branding in advertisements themselves
- Applying Buy Now CTAs on TikTok
This simple change reduced drop-offs dramatically. Users could purchase without leaving the app.
3. Add Retargeting Using TikTok Pixel
We actually had TikTok Pixel implemented but were not using it effectively. The agency:- Configure custom events for checkout, purchase, and add-to-cart
- Developed retargeting funnels for warm audiences:
- Saw the product but did not buy? Show them a discount ad.
- Placed in cart but forgotten? Target urgency-led creators.
- Created lookalike audiences from buyers to scale acquisition.
The end result? An ongoing feedback loop, refining each pound we spent.
4. Started A/B Testing at Scale
Instead of relying on intuition, they employed facts. Every campaign possessed:- A few ad variations with different hooks, headlines, and CTAs
- Split tests for:
- Short-form versus mid-length videos
- Straight sales pitch vs. lifestyle narrative
Winner ads were promoted by Spark Ads for further exposure
5. Multi-Channel Influencer Partnerships
TikTok is driven by creatives. We used UK micro-influencers (10K–50K followers) whose niche was relevant to our industry. Benefits were:- Social proof—actual voices supporting our products
- Quicker trend following—influencers understand what is happening now
- Affordable reach when compared with macro-influencers
